Output fc8d58781cb2ae89ddaa74fa3360eaf5831df3f6fc4aab2bbab74d968dc6ea46:0

value
3309829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f0c287ce894b5a5911058cdf6d78acd3ca763dc OP_EQUAL
address
38tysTjtd8vyyF7i7G7vK4sDUZ2tSv6qig
transaction
fc8d58781cb2ae89ddaa74fa3360eaf5831df3f6fc4aab2bbab74d968dc6ea46
confirmations
17552
spent
true